Not sure if I'm going to be able to save them or not, as they're currently camped out in the back corner of the tank, but it's a start! I count 6 of them right now...

Well...this is day 1 after release, so they've got a ways to go yet. They do appear to be eating frozen baby brine and rotifers I've squirted in their direction though.

Perhaps raising them together might net you a pair or harem. I'm not sure, but I don't believe the Banggais are hermaphroditic. I've got a trio, but the lone female is mostly left out by the other two. The female of my pair has actually been standing watch over the babies, which is kind of neat to watch. They've taken up hosting in a little 5-6 polyp zoanthid growth that seems to be growing behind the rock in the back corner of the tank!
 
Heh, you'll lose these guys in a tank that size. There are still five of them this morning, and momma seems to be keeping a watchful eye on them. Dad just hovers around the front of the tank waiting for food!
 
Discovered a few more this evening lurking in the tank. I think official count right now is 9 total. They seem to be doing well on their own and have put on some noticeable size, nearing 3/8", should be 1/2"+ within a couple weeks. They already recognize me as the man with the net and have evaded all my attempts to capture them so far!
